In the mid-1990s, the children of divorced parents were about ____ times more likely to divorce than their peers from intact families.

Sagot :

In the mid-1990s, the children of divorced parents were about 1.5 times more likely to divorce than their peers from intact families.

The rise in divorce cases

  • A plethora of other societal issues is made worse by the divorce and marriage division that is growing in America.
  • For instance, the disintegration of marriage in working-class and impoverished communities has significantly contributed to the growth of inequality and poverty.
  • According to Isabel Sawhill of the Brookings Institution, family dissolution is largely to blame for the rise in child poverty that has occurred in the United States since the 1990s.
  • In the meantime, the breakdown of marriage in working-class and impoverished areas has also spurred the development of government, as federal, state, and local governments spend more money on welfare, courts, police, and prisons in an effort to patch up the shards of shattered families.
